NOTE: When the Coffee Maker is first plugged in or when power is restored after an
interruption, the display will initially show 12:00.
1.
Cord is stored in the base. If needed, gently pull cord outwards. Plug into an earthed
outlet.
2.
Press H to set the hour. The hour digits will change with each press; or press and hold to
scroll rapidly.
3.
Press Min to set the minutes.
To save the current displayed time and exit clock set-up: Press any other button or do not
press any button for 10 seconds.
Voltage: 220-240 V
Frequency: 50-60 Hz
Power: 1100 W
NOTE: If the plug does not fit in the outlet,
contact a qualified electrician. Do not modify
the plug in any way. Do not use an adapter.
Do not use an extension cord. If the power
supply cord is too short, have a qualified
electrician or service technician to install an
outlet near the appliance.
The cord should be arranged so that it will not
drape over the countertop or tabletop where it
can be pulled on by children or tripped over
unintentionally.
